Re: Boxing Off-Topic
Generous scoring for Chavez (97-92, 98-91, 96-93) including counting an intentional headbutt in his favor for a point.
The 168 division isn't nearly as heralded (or overrated) as it was when the 2009-2011 Super Six Tourney took place. Frosh, Kessler, and Jermain Taylor are gone. Arthur Abraham was exposed by Frosh, Dirrell, and Ward in that tournament, hasn't beaten anybody significant since then (KOed Stieglitz tonight), yet stands as the second best 168 guy, miles behind Andre Ward.
Besides Ward, there is an opportunity for Chavez, but I think he will fail. I don't think he touches the Top Ten of a relatively weak division for another year, year and a half. He wants to fight like a bully all the time even when he's not the bully (Fonfara), abandoning head movement, the jab, and any good defensive strategy.
You can't teach an old dog new tricks, especially when it's Canine, Jr.Comment
